Achievers in Medical Science Doctoral Scholarship |
This scholarship is intended to assist in attracting and retaining international-caliber students to the University of Calgary’s graduate medical programs. |

Eligibility |
Open to students registered full-time in the first year of a doctoral degree program in the Cumming School of Medicine. Students must be registered in their first year or in the first semester of their second year at time of the award start date.
Applicants must complete a statement of eligibility (approximately 300 words) describing how they meet the eligibility criteria.
Students are required to submit additional documentation, including a supervisor CV and training environment statement. Complete instructions on what is required found at https://cumming.ucalgary.ca/gse/current-students/scholarships
Students funded through the Achievers in Medical Science Doctoral Scholarship (AIMS) are required to apply for all provincial, national or international scholarships for which they are eligible. Students who win external awards will have their AIMS adjusted as follows:
• Students winning one or more external awards totaling $5,000 or less will hold the full AIMS • Students winning one or more external awards totaling $5,001 or higher will have the AIMS adjusted for a combined total of $35,000 • Students winning one or more external awards totaling $30,000 or higher will receive a $5,000 AIMS top-up |
